  • Title

    A strategy of minimising wind power curtailment by considering operation capacity credit

  • Abstract
    An optimal wind power curtailment strategy considering operation capacity credit is proposed in this paper to minimize the uncertain wind power curtailment and minimize the system operation cost. The relevant definitions in capacity credit assessment are applied in the power system operation situation. Based on operation capacity credit prediction, the optimal operation control strategy is defined and implemented for hourly system operation and control. Multi-agent system based control structure is adopted to coordinate the diverse system components to work together and realize the system wide targets of the proposed strategy. The simulation results demonstrate the effectiveness of the proposed strategy.
